Transaction 7870cbdd790ca2d4679d3a3265a78afdd46ef134e2d7445d761066a299927d05

70 Input
1 Outputs
  • 7870cbdd790ca2d4679d3a3265a78afdd46ef134e2d7445d761066a299927d05:0
  • value  4179412
    address  37CB9zG2yGyM4xZYacGKwn1728QtuZEyJj